Braemar Hotels to franchise Sofitel Chicago Magnificent Mile

Real estate investment trust Braemar Hotels & Resorts plans to convert the brand-managed Sofitel Chicago Magnificent Mile into a franchise. The strategic change is slated to take effect next month, with the hotel continuing to operate under the Sofitel brand.

The franchise transition will see Remington Hospitality managing the 415-room hotel under the current terms of its master hotel management agreement with Braemar. Remington Hospitality will give offers for all employees employed on the conversion date to remain in their current positions as employees of a subsidiary of Remington Hospitality.

Braemar said that no property improvement plan is mandatory for the conversion but the company plans to upgrade the hotel’s lobby, restaurant and meeting spaces within the next two years.

“We are pleased to announce the conversion of the Sofitel Chicago Magnificent Mile from being brand-managed to a franchise, and we look forward to working with the Accor team in this new capacity," Braemar President and CEO Richard J Stockton said in a statement. "We expect an immediate uplift in the value of the property due to the Sofitel brand remaining on the hotel and the management agreement with Remington being terminable on sale.”

Last month, Braemar closed on a $363 million refinancing deal for five of its hotels, including the Sofitel Chicago Magnificent Mile. The loan has an initial two-year term with the potential for three one-year extensions, subject to specific conditions being met. This arrangement could extend the loan's final maturity to 2030, the company said.
